Abstract
The invention provides a screening method of an optimal process for preparing water insoluble dietary fibers from pineapple fruit residues. The screening method is mainly composed of influence ranges of following influence factors: the mass percent of sodium hydroxide is 1%-5%; the material-liquid ratio ranges from (1:10) to (1:30); the alkaline hydrolysis time is 30-70 minutes; and the temperature is 40-80 DEG C. The additional value of a deeply-processed product can be further improved by a research of the dietary fibers in pineapples and an industrial chain of the machining of the pineapples is prolonged; and meanwhile, the screening method has the extremely profound practical significance on improvement on the health level of people in China.
Description
technical field [0001] The invention relates to a screening method, in particular to a screening method for preparing water-insoluble dietary fiber from pineapple pomace. Background technique [0002] Pineapple (scientific name: Ananas comosus), commonly known as pineapple, is one of the famous tropical fruits. Fujian and Taiwan are called Wangli or Wanglai (), Singapore and Malaysia are called yellow pears, Chaoshan areas are called fanli, and mainland China and Hong Kong are called pineapple. There are more than 70 varieties, one of the four famous fruits in Lingnan. [0003] Pineapples are native to the Amazon River Basin in Brazil and Paraguay in South America, and were introduced to China from Brazil in the 16th century. It has now spread throughout the tropics. The edible part is mainly composed of fleshy enlarged inflorescence rachis and spirally arranged flowers around the periphery.
